The cheapest way to get from Boston Landing Station to Back Bay is to tram which costs $3 and takes 40 min.
The fastest way to get from Boston Landing Station to Back Bay is to taxi which takes 6 min and costs $15 - $19.
Yes, there is a direct bus departing from Brighton Ave @ Cambridge St and arriving at Kenmore. Services depart every 15 minutes, and operate every day. The journey takes approximately 15 min.
Yes, there is a direct train departing from Boston Landing and arriving at Back Bay. Services depart hourly, and operate every day. The journey takes approximately 13 min.
The distance between Boston Landing Station and Back Bay is 4 miles.
The best way to get from Boston Landing Station to Back Bay without a car is to train which takes 13 min and costs $1 - $6.
The train from Boston Landing to Back Bay takes 13 min including transfers and departs hourly.
Boston Landing Station to Back Bay bus services, operated by MBTA, depart from Brighton Ave @ Cambridge St station.
Boston Landing Station to Back Bay train services, operated by MBTA, depart from Boston Landing station.
The best way to get from Boston Landing Station to Back Bay is to train which takes 13 min and costs $1 - $6. Alternatively, you can line 57 bus, which costs $1 - $5 and takes 23 min.
